Product introduction


Air preheater, or boiler preheater, is an important boiler part. It can be divided into two kinds, Tubular type air preheater and Vertical type air preheater.
Air preheater pipe type, mainly using industrial furnaces or smoke waste heat boiler combustion air preheating furnace enter, such not only improves the thermal efficiency of the stove and reduce the environment pollution.

1. A device,which increases the tempurature of air before it supply to the furnance using heat from flue gases passing through chimney.

2. The heat carried with the flue gases coming out of economiser is further utilised for preheating the air before supplying to the combustion chamber.

3. An increase of 20 degree centigrade in the air temp.increases the boiler efficiency by1%.

4. It is a necessary equipment to supply hot air for drying the coal in pulverised fuel systems to facilitate grinding and satisfactory combustion of fuel in the furnace.

 

 

 

Fuctions


1. Improve and strengthen combustion

The air after the waste heat enters the furnace, accelerates the fuel drying, ignition and combustion process, ensures the stable combustion in the boiler, and improves the combustion efficiency.
2. Strengthen heat transfer
As the combustion in the furnace has been improved and strengthened, and the temperature of hot air entering the furnace has been increased, the average temperature level in the furnace has also been increased, so as to strengthen the radiation heat transfer in the furnace.
3. Reduce the loss in the furnace, reduce the smoke discharge temperature, and improve the boiler's thermal efficiency
Because the combustion in the furnace is stable and the radiation heat exchange is strengthened, the chemical incomplete combustion loss can be reduced. On the other hand, the air preheater makes use of the waste heat of flue gas to further reduce the loss of smoke exhaust, so as to improve the boiler's thermal efficiency. According to experience, when the air preheater in rise by 1.5 ℃, exhaust temperature can reduce 1 ℃. After installation of air preheater in boiler flue, if we can put the air heat 150-160 ℃, can reduce exhaust temperature 110-120 ℃, the boiler thermal efficiency can be increased by 7% - 7.5%. You can save 11 to 12 percent on fuel.
4, hot air can be used as fuel desiccant

For laminar combustion furnace, hot air can be used as fuel with high moisture and ash content. For power plant boiler, hot air is an important desiccant and coal powder conveying medium in the fat and powder system.

Working process


1. Hot flue gases enters into tubes from the top of the shell and leaves from to the chinmney.

2. The inlet air at R.Tem. is admitted into the shell with the help of the fan.

3. The air passes upward around the tubes in the opposite direction to the flow of the hot gases.

4. Baffeles increases the total path length of air thus increase heat transfer.
